Hi,
Would a desktop: Intel Core i7 4790 (3.6 GHz)
8 GB DDR3 1 TB HDD 8 GB SSD
Windows 8.1 64-Bit
NVIDIA GeForce GTX 760 2 GB


be able to emulate at 4k ?

I'd rather avoid it
- A Prebuilt PC is overpriced with poor components . I would build my own PC instead of wasting a couple of hundred bucks on it
- Lowest rated PC I have ever seen . I don't think I would consider buying it after seeing most reviews are like "Worst Computer I have EVER owned. Hands down." , Didn't last 7 months , "Avoid this at all costs!" and many more ...
Quote:be able to emulate at 4k ?
No , you will need at least a GTX 960 for that

Ok , then
EVGA GTX 960 Superclocked for ITX build $180
Corsair Black Aluminum ITX case $85 or Cooler Master Elite 130 $ 44
Asrock Z97E ITX $130
Pentium 20th Anniversary G3258 $70
Noctua NH-L9i Cooler $42
Arctic MX-4 $10
EVGA 500W 80plus PSU $40
GSkill X Series 8GB dual channel $40

Total : $597 Max or $556 Min . Overclocking is the whole point of this build .
Edit : Forgot to add Seagate 1TB SSHD $70
Here is an idea of how powerful the G3258 is !
If you don't like overclocking , just swap out G3258 for i7 4790k . The i7 4790k can turbo up to 4.4GHz automatically
